行业资讯
软件开发工程师:如何快速提升技能?——访谈记录
受访人:李明,资深软件开发工程师;
采访者:王芳,人力资源经理。
问:您觉得一个初入职场的软件开发工程师需要掌握哪些基本技能?
答:首先,熟练掌握至少一种编程语言是必须的。比如Python、Java或者JavaScript等;其次,了解常见的设计模式和架构原则;此外,熟悉版本控制工具如Git也很重要。
问:那么在项目管理方面,有哪些值得学习的知识点?
答:需求分析:理解业务需求并转化为技术方案。
代码重构:优化现有代码结构和逻辑;
性能调优:提高应用程序运行效率。
问:除了技术能力,软技能方面需要注意哪些呢?
答:沟通表达能力非常重要。在团队协作中要能够清晰地与同事交流想法。
问题解决能力也不能忽视,面对复杂的问题要学会如何分解和处理。
持续学习的态度也很关键,行业知识和技术更新很快。
问:您能分享一下自己的成长经历吗?
答:我最初加入一家初创公司担任开发人员。由于资源有限,需要参与从需求分析到上线的全部流程。这段经历让我学会了如何快速适应不同角色并提升跨部门协作能力。
总结:通过以上访谈可以看出,成为一位优秀的软件开发工程师不仅需要扎实的技术基础,还需要具备良好的沟通能力和学习习惯。建议新人在工作中多实践、多思考,并主动寻求反馈以不断进步。
免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。